--- loncom/interface/lonprintout.pm 2006/07/18 18:19:51 1.464 +++ loncom/interface/lonprintout.pm 2006/08/02 20:49:55 1.474 @@ -1,7 +1,8 @@ +# # The LearningOnline Network # Printout # -# $Id: lonprintout.pm,v 1.464 2006/07/18 18:19:51 albertel Exp $ +# $Id: lonprintout.pm,v 1.474 2006/08/02 20:49:55 www Exp $ # # Copyright Michigan State University Board of Trustees # @@ -892,7 +893,7 @@ sub IndexCreation { sub print_latex_header { my $mode=shift; - my $output='\documentclass[letterpaper,twoside]{article}'; + my $output='\documentclass[letterpaper,twoside]{article}\raggedbottom'; if (($mode eq 'batchmode') || (!$perm{'pav'})) { $output.='\batchmode'; } @@ -2064,7 +2065,7 @@ sub init_perm { $perm{'pav'}=&Apache::lonnet::allowed('pav', $env{'request.course.id'}.'/'.$env{'request.course.sec'}); } - $perm{'pfo'}=&Apache::lonnet::allowed('pav',$env{'request.course.id'}); + $perm{'pfo'}=&Apache::lonnet::allowed('pfo',$env{'request.course.id'}); if (!$perm{'pfo'}) { $perm{'pfo'}=&Apache::lonnet::allowed('pfo', $env{'request.course.id'}.'/'.$env{'request.course.sec'}); @@ -2241,10 +2242,15 @@ sub printHelper { $helper->declareVar('SEQUENCE'); + # If we're in a sequence... + my $start_new_option; + if ($perm{'pav'}) { + $start_new_option = + "